They Are Back…

In 1993, the Dutch band “De Jazz Politie” wrote a song titled “Ze Zijn Terug,” which translates into English as They Are Back. The song was a protest against the rise of right-wing radicalism and neo-Nazism. The song is described from the perspective of a Holocaust survivor who relives her experiences through the right-wing radical … Continue reading They Are Back…